For this, I started by picking a rose. I originally wanted to photograph the rose with a reflection in water, but I couldn’t find any water that was reflective enough in the given lighting conditions. So, I used a small mirror that I have that is specifically curved so that the reflection is “zoomed in”. I used this side of the mirror because I wanted the reflection to be a little warped. I then brought it into Photoshop so that I could add more blues into the picture, so that it wasn’t only peach and grey. I thought that would add more visual interest.
